+/* Algol 68 multiples are multi-dimensional and dynamically sized. They have a
+ static part and a dynamic part. The static part is conformed by a
+ "descriptor", which contains information about each of the dimensions, and a
+ pointer to the actual elements stored in the multiple. The dynamic part are
+ the elements, which are stored in column order. Both the descriptor and the
+ elements may reside on the stack, data section, or the heap. The mode of a
+ multiple is a "row".
+
+ Schematically, the descriptor contains:
+
+ triplets%
+ lb% ub% stride%
+ ...
+ elements%
+ elements_size%
+
+ Where elements_size% is the size of the buffer pointed by elements%, in
+ bytes.
+
+ There is a triplet per dimension in the multiple. The number of dimensions
+ in a row mode is static and is determined at compile-time.
+
+ The infomation stored for each triplet is:
+
+ lb% is the lower bound of the dimension.
+ ub% is the upper bound of the dimension.
+ stride% is the stride of the dimension.
+
+ The stride of each dimension is the number of bytes to skip in order to
+ access the next element in that dimension. They express the layout of the
+ multiple in memory.
+
+ Algol 68 multi-dimensional multiples are stored in row-major (generalized,
+ lexicographical) order:
+
+ [1:3,1:2]AMODE = ((e1, e2, e3),
+ (e4, e5, e6))
+
+ is stored as:
+
+ 1 2 3
+ 1 e1 e2 e3 | stride 2S -> stride 1S
+ 2 e4 e5 e6 v
+
+ Where S is the size in bytes of a single element. That means that for two
+ dimensional multiples, the column stride is always 1S and the row stride is
+ the column size.
+
+ In general, given a mode with number of elements N1, N2, N3, ...:
+
+ [N1,N2,N3...,Nn]AMODE
+
+ the strides of the dimensions are:
+
+ S1 = N2 * S2
+ S2 = N3 * S3
+ S3 = N4 * S4
+ ...
+ Si = N1 * N2 * ... * Ni-1
+
+ Indexing is then performed by a dot-product of an element coordinate and the
+ strides:
+
+ (i1,i2,i3) . (S1,S2,S3) = offset + i1*S1 + i2*S2 + i3*S3 = index in
elements array.
+
+ Note that the number of elements in each dimension can be easily derived
+ from the bounds and there is no need to store them explicitly, save for
+ performance reasons. Descriptors are bulky enough and often they they are
+ stored on the stack, so we prefer to pay in performance and save in
+ storage. */

+/* Algol 68 unions are implemented in this front-end as a data structure
+ consisting of an overhead followed by a value:
+
+ overhead%
+ value%
+
+ Where overhead% is an index that identifies the kind of object currently
+ united, and value% is a GENERIC union. The value currently united in the
+ union is the overhead%-th field in value%.
+
+ At the language level there are no values of union modes in Algol 68. All
+ values are built from either SKIP (for uninitialized UNION values) or as the
+ result of an uniting coercion. */
